As an Unarmed Patrol Officer in an educational setting, you will monitor and patrol assigned areas, maintain a visible presence to help deter incidents, support access control, and provide outstanding customer service to students, staff, and visitors. You will communicate clearly, respond professionally to security-related concerns, and contribute to a welcoming environment.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service to students, staff, visitors, and/or vendors while car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and when appropriate, emergency response activities.
  • Respond to incidents, student-related concerns, and critical situations in a calm, professional, problem-solving manner, following established school protocols.
  • Conduct regular and random unarmed patrols of school buildings, classrooms, common areas, entrances, parking areas, and the surrounding perimeter to help identify and report unusual conditions.
  • Monitor access points and observe visitor activity in accordance with site procedures; report unauthorized access, maintenance concerns, and/or suspicious activity to appropriate personnel.
  • Prepare clear, accurate reports and communicate observations, incidents, and policy concerns to site leadership and Allied Universal management.
